HC Deb 08 July 1946 vol 425 cc36-7W
Mr. A. Lewis

asked the Secretary of State for the Home Department if he will give an assurance that any person or persons known to have financed or supported Fascist organisations will not be allowed to re-enter this country for the purpose of opening or reopening business concerns.

Mr. Ede

In deciding whether persons shall be admitted to the United Kingdom under the Aliens Order, consideration is given to the question whether an individual is known to have Fascist sympathies, but examination during the war of many of the people who were interned showed that it would be a mistake to conclude that because an individual had subscribed to some Fascist organisation he must necessarily be in sympathy with Fascist ideas.
